Diamond

The hardest gemstone, and routinely assumed to be indestructible. GIA is explicit that it is not: diamonds resist scratching, but a hard blow can cleave or fracture one.
Properties
| Property | Value | Authority |
|---|---|---|
| Mohs hardness | 10 — the hardest gemstone [1] | — |
| Toughness | Not the toughest despite being the hardest. GIA: while they resist scratching and abrasions, diamonds can be cleaved or fractured by a hard blow. [1] The single clearest demonstration that hardness and toughness are different properties. | — |
| Refractive index | 2.417–2.419 [2] | — |
| Specific gravity | 3.50–3.53 [2] | — |
| Crystal system | Cubic [4] | — |
| Suitability for daily wear | Excellent for daily wear on the hardness axis. Chipping remains possible at the girdle from a hard knock, which a protective setting mitigates. [1] | — |
| Birthstone month | April [3] | — |
